Why These Are the Top Walk-in Tubs Contractors in Conetoe

** The walk-in tub market for Conetoe, NC, is characterized by a reliance on regional service providers from larger neighboring hubs like Greenville, Rocky Mount, and Wilson. Due to the rural nature of the area, there is moderate competition among these established regional companies, all of whom are accustomed to serving a wider geographic area. The average quality of service is high, as these companies have built their reputations on reliability and specializing in senior and ADA-compliant solutions. Typical pricing for a complete walk-in tub solution (tub and professional installation) in this region generally starts from **$4,500** for a basic, non-jetted model and can range up to **$12,000 - $15,000** for high-end models featuring hydrotherapy jets, heated surfaces, and quick-drain technology. The final cost is highly dependent on the specific tub model chosen and the complexity of the installation, such as whether plumbing or electrical modifications are required. All top providers offer financing options and strong product warranties to remain competitive.

Frequently Asked Questions About Walk-in Tubs in Conetoe

Get answers to common questions about walk-in tubs services in Conetoe, North Carolina.

1What is the typical cost range for a walk-in tub installation in Conetoe, and are there any local factors that affect the price?

In the Conetoe and Eastern North Carolina area, a complete walk-in tub purchase and professional installation typically ranges from $5,000 to $15,000, depending on the tub's features and the complexity of the bathroom retrofit. Local factors include the age of your home's plumbing, which may need updating to meet current NC codes, and potential accessibility modifications to your bathroom layout. We recommend getting itemized quotes from local providers that clearly separate tub cost, installation labor, and any necessary construction work.

2How long does a full walk-in tub installation take for a home in Conetoe, and should I consider the season when scheduling?

From the initial consultation to final walk-through, the process usually takes 4 to 8 weeks, with the physical installation itself often completed in 1-3 days. Given Conetoe's humid subtropical climate, scheduling during the drier fall or spring months can be advantageous, as it minimizes disruption from potential coastal storm systems and allows for better ventilation during adhesive curing and paint drying compared to our hot, humid summers.

3Are there specific permits or regulations in Conetoe or Edgecombe County I need to be aware of for a walk-in tub installation?

Yes, most walk-in tub installations in Conetoe will require a permit from the Edgecombe County Building Inspections Department, as the work involves significant plumbing and electrical alterations. A reputable local installer will handle this permitting process for you. The installation must comply with the North Carolina State Building Code, which includes specific requirements for grab bar reinforcement, valve positioning, and safe drainage to prevent slips and falls.

4What should I look for when choosing a walk-in tub service provider in the Conetoe area?

Prioritize providers who are locally licensed, insured, and have verifiable physical addresses in Eastern NC. Look for companies with extensive experience in retrofitting older homes common in our area, as they will be familiar with dealing with pier-and-beam foundations or cast iron plumbing. Always ask for and contact local references in nearby towns like Tarboro or Princeville to confirm their reliability and quality of workmanship.

5I'm concerned about my water heater keeping up with a deep-soaking walk-in tub. Is this a common issue in our area?

This is a very valid concern, especially in older Conetoe homes that may have standard 40-50 gallon water heaters. A walk-in tub holds significantly more water than a standard tub. A reputable local installer will assess your current water heater's capacity and may recommend an upgrade to a larger tank or a tankless model to ensure a comfortable, full bath. They should also consider your home's water pressure, which can vary in our more rural settings.
